Sustained transaminase elevation after pancreatoduodenectomy defines a liver perfusion failure phenotype associated with markedly increased morbidity and mortality ➡️ do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… Liver perfusion failure (LPF) following partial or total pancreatoduodenectomy lacks a consensus definition, contributing to systematic underreporting of an ischaemic complication with substantial clinical consequence. This single-centre analysis of 815 consecutive patients resected between 2014 and 2017 tested four candidate definitions and identified an alanine aminotransferase/aspartate aminotransferase elevation ≥ 200 U/l on two consecutive postoperative days (LPF_2d) as the most clinically discriminative model, with an overall LPF rate of 9.9% and the highest area under the curve (0.738) among the models evaluated. Moderate or severe LPF was associated with higher rates of liver-specific complications (40.4% versus 2.9%), postoperative liver failure (30.8% versus 1.6%), major complications (48.1% versus 14.6%) and 90-day mortality (21.2% versus 2.9%). Angiography-guided thyroidectomy was both cost-saving and health-improving compared with conventional thyroidectomy in a Spanish National Health System model. ➡️ do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… Postoperative hypoparathyroidism is the most frequent complication of total thyroidectomy and imposes lifelong monitoring, supplementation, and quality-of-life burden. This model-based economic evaluation compared angiography-guided thyroidectomy, in which indocyanine green fluorescence maps parathyroid arterial supply before dissection, with conventional total thyroidectomy from the perspective of the Spanish National Health System, using a state-transition Markov model over a 35-year horizon with 3.5% annual discounting and a willingness-to-pay threshold of €30 000 per quality-adjusted life-year. Angiography-guided thyroidectomy was associated with lower lifetime costs (€563.7 million versus €613.2 million) and greater health benefit (310 997 versus 299 107 QALYs), yielding 11 889 incremental QALYs and an incremental net monetary benefit of €406.2 million (95% uncertainty interval €381.7 million to €431.5 million). Dominance persisted across deterministic, probabilistic, scenario, and bootstrap analyses, with breakeven activity of approximately 147 thyroidectomies per centre per year. Impact of thromboprophylaxis timing and duration on thromboembolism and bleeding in metabolic bariatric surgery ➡️do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… Optimal timing and duration of thromboprophylaxis in metabolic bariatric surgery remain uncertain despite guideline recommendations based largely on expert consensus. This nationwide registry-based cohort study used data from the Scandinavian Obesity Surgery Registry, including 83,801 primary bariatric procedures performed in Sweden between 2008 and 2023, to evaluate associations between thromboprophylaxis timing and duration and the risk of venous thromboembolism (VTE) and bleeding. The overall incidence of VTE was low (0.1%), while intraoperative and postoperative bleeding occurred in 0.7% and 1.6% of patients, respectively. Postoperative initiation of thromboprophylaxis was associated with a significantly lower risk of intraoperative bleeding compared with preoperative initiation (odds ratio 0.52; 95% confidence interval 0.37–0.74), with no corresponding increase in VTE risk. Neither the timing nor the duration of thromboprophylaxis was significantly associated with VTE or postoperative bleeding. Hospital-level structural, staffing, and system characteristics are associated with variation in failure to rescue after surgery. ➡️ do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… Failure to rescue (FTR), defined as death following a postoperative complication, is a key driver of between-hospital variation in surgical mortality, yet the institutional characteristics underlying this variation remain inconsistently described. This systematic review and meta-analysis synthesised 111 observational studies encompassing more than 137 million surgical patients and 301 hospital-level factors across structural, staffing, and system domains. Lower FTR was associated with larger hospitals (OR 0.85, 95% c.i. 0.74 to 0.97), greater intensive care unit capacity (OR 0.80, 0.71 to 0.90), and teaching status (OR 0.88, 0.83 to 0.93), while nursing resources showed the most consistent associations, including patient-to-nurse ratios (OR 1.07, 1.03 to 1.10) and more favourable work environments (OR 0.93, 0.90 to 0.95). Safety-net hospital status was associated with higher FTR (OR 1.22, 1.03 to 1.45), with substantial heterogeneity across analyses. A Bayesian, electronic medical record–derived algorithm enables near-real-time monitoring of postoperative complication rates after major colorectal surgery ➡️do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… Conventional surgical quality assurance programmes, including large national registries, are resource-intensive and rely on frequentist methods that report adverse events months after they occur, limiting their capacity to inform timely intervention. This retrospective cohort study developed an artificial intelligence–assisted algorithm to extract surgical outcomes directly from the electronic medical record and applied Bayesian binomial models with non-informative priors to estimate the posterior probability of complications among 747 patients who underwent major colorectal operations at a single academic health system between 2016 and 2024. Postoperative ileus (7.4%) and anastomotic leak (3.9%) were the most frequent complications, whereas postoperative bleeding was rare (0.3%); across the ten tracked complications, the number of events triggering chart review ranged from two in 2016 to six in 2022, with no more than three excess complications in any single year. Applying an 80% posterior probability threshold for exceeding institution-derived benchmarks produced a manageable volume of cases for review, whereas a conventional 95% threshold flagged almost none, illustrating the limitations of fixed-α rules under repeated monitoring. Multi-outcome prognostic modelling for older adults after trauma: development and validation of the Older Trauma Outcome Predictor (OTOP) model ➡️do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… This study developed and validated the Older Trauma Outcome Prediction (OTOP) model, the first prognostic tool designed to predict multiple inpatient outcomes in older trauma patients. Using data from more than 105 000 patients in the Western Australia Trauma Registry, OTOP accurately predicted mortality, surgical intervention, intensive care unit (ICU) admission, length of hospital stay, medical complications, and discharge destination. The model demonstrated excellent performance for mortality, surgery, and ICU admission and outperformed existing mortality-focused tools. Implications and risk of new versus persisting intraductal papillary mucinous neoplasms after pancreatic surgery: meta-analysis ➡️do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… Recurrence rate of intraductal papillary mucinous neoplasms (IPMN)-derived pancreatic cancer is high and warrants close surveillance policies. The majority of ‘recurring’ non-invasive IPMNs are de novo , metachronous lesions. Hospital costs associated with complications following pancreatoduodenectomy: systematic review ➡️doi.org/10.1093/bjsope… This systematic review, including 46 studies encompassing 111 215 patients from 13 countries, quantified the hospital costs of complications following pancreatoduodenectomy, with all figures adjusted for inflation and purchasing power parity to 2023 Dutch euros. Clinically relevant complications imposed substantial financial burdens, with grade B postoperative pancreatic fistula adding €1998–€25 228 and grade C up to €112 824, while delayed gastric emptying, postpancreatectomy haemorrhage, biliary leak, and higher Clavien–Dindo grades similarly escalated costs.
